Coach Emery announces departure from Paris Saint-Germain

Paris, April 27 (IANS) Paris Saint-Germain head coach Unai Emery said on Friday he would not be extending his contract, which expires in June, with the French football champions.

The Spanish coach announced to press that he had told the other players of his departure following a meeting with the club's sporting director Antero Henrique, reported Efe.

"We have decided that we will not continue together next season," Emery said in a press conference.

Emery, 46, has coached PSG since 2016 and, during his tenure, the team has dominated at the national French level, though the Parisians recently lost to Real Madrid at home and away in UEFA Champions League play this season.

"I thank president Nasser Al Khelaifi, the director of sport Antero Henrique, the supporters and all the players for these two seasons," he added.

During the press conference, the coach discussed the situation of Brazil star Neymar, who joined PSG earlier this season from Barcelona for a record fee of 222 million euros ($267.83 million).

Emery acknowledged that changes from an old team to a new team always involve some difficulties, but he advised Neymar to keep playing with the French superpower.
